A new accelerated mechanism of protons in high power laser-plasma

  • In order to study effect of Compton scattering on protons accelerated along the normal direction of the target back side in the plasma,based on the model of multi-photon nonlinear Compton scattering and plasma particle-in cell simulation,the accelerated protons were analyzed and simulated,and a new mechanism of protons accelerated by the electrostatic field formed by incident laser and Compton scattering on the plasma face was put forward,then some important data were given out.The results show that the energetic electron numbers induced by Compton scattering in plasma are increased so that the electrostatic field on the target face of the energetic electrons is increased,and higher accelerated energy is absorbed by the protons.The proton gets the accelerated energy from the plasma of the gradual density scale length by Compton scattering higher than the energy getting from the plasma of the steep density scale length,and the key cause is that the effect of the electrostatic field increased by Compton scattering effectively compensates the loss energy of the electron in the transporting energy to the plasma as the increasing of the laser modulation instability taking place under Compton scattering.Therefore,it is perfect to accelerate protons with plasma of the gradual density scale length under Compton scattering.
